Runtipi : solution open source pour les applications auto-hébergées

Runtipi est une solution open source permettant de simplifier la gestion d’applications auto-hébergées. Idéale pour monter un homelab sur un Mini-PC, Raspberry Pi ou un NAS, la plate-forme permet de déployer des services sans passer des heures à configurer Docker manuellement. Découvrons ensemble RunTipi…

Tuntipi - Runtipi : solution open source pour les applications auto-hébergées

Runtipi : centralisation & automatisation

Runtipi centralise l’installation, les mises à jour et la sauvegarde de près de 300 applications via une interface Web intuitive. Que vous souhaitiez monter un environnement multimédia ou de productivité, tout se fait en quelques clics, sans écrire de fichiers Compose complexes. Chaque application tourne dans un conteneur isolé derrière un reverse proxy Traefik géré automatiquement, avec des sauvegardes et restaurations guidées pour limiter les risques de perte de données.

La compatibilité avec la plupart des distributions Linux en fait une solution flexible pour un Mini-PC, un Raspberry Pi ou encore une VM légère sur un NAS. Pour les usages multimédias (Jellyfin, Sonarr/Radar) avec quelques utilitaires (AdGuard Home, Authentik, Vaultwarden) il est recommandé d’avoir un processeur Quad Core et 8 à 16 Go de RAM pour un fonctionnement fluide au quotidien. Avec un Raspberry Pi, il faudra donc rester attentif aux performances…

RunTipi Appstore - Runtipi : solution open source pour les applications auto-hébergées

Fonctionnalités clés

RunTipi va simplifier l’installation et l’utilisation au quotidien des outils avec :

  • Catalogue d’applications : environ 300 applications disponibles, allant de l’archivage web aux serveurs multimédias, en passant par les outils IA, l’automatisation et la sécurité ;
  • Tableau de bord moderne : surveillez le statut du système, installez et configurez vos applications, effectuez des sauvegardes et mises à jour, le tout depuis une interface Web unique ;
  • Sécurité par conception : chaque service est isolé dans son conteneur et géré via Traefik…

Installation et première mise en route

Le guide officiel explique comment préparer un serveur Linux minimal sécurisé, lancer l’initialisation de Runtipi et accéder au tableau de bord, sans connaissances approfondies en ligne de commande. En pratique, l’installation se résume à exécuter un script officiel sur une distribution type Debian/Ubuntu pré-installée, puis à terminer la configuration via l’interface web.

Voici la commande à taper pour installer RunTipi : curl -L https://setup.runtipi.io | bash

Déployer et personnaliser des applications

Une fois Runtipi installé, l’App Store permet d’installer vos applications en un clic. Les champs de configuration guidés facilitent la mise en route et les mises à jour se font en un seul clic. Bien sûr, les utilisateurs avancés peuvent personnaliser le compose via un fichier tipi-compose.yml dans user-config pour exposer le tableau de bord Traefik ou ajuster des ports, sans modifier le compose de base régénérée à chaque redémarrage.

En synthèse

Runtipi constitue une base solide pour construire un homelab fiable et facile pour un Mini PC et/ou avec un NAS. Son catalogue riche, ses mises à jour en un clic, ses sauvegardes intégrées et ses fonctionnalités avancées en font une solution complète. Pour démarrer sereinement, on vous recommande de suivre le guide officiel afin d’installer vos premières applications, puis affiner la personnalisation via user-config et Traefik selon vos besoins.

Sachez qu’il est tout à fait possible de tester RunTipi : demo.runtipi.io avec l’identifiant user@runtipi.io et le mode de passe password.

  1. Merci pour la présentation de ce HomeLab.
    Mais en quoi diffère-t-il des autres comme : CasaOS, Umbrel, StartOS, Clouderon, …?

    Une des critiques de ces Home-Labs:
    – util pour tester, mais en production c’est difficile à maintenir, est ce que cela sera bien suivi dans le temps ?
    Est ce que sur ce point critique, RunTipi est différent ?

    Un des avantages de RunTipi, c est qui’il vient d’Allemagne, donc Eu.

    Par avance merci pour vos retours

    1. Pour avoir testé à plusieurs reprises ces « consoles d’applications Docker », Runtipi ne présente que peu d’intérêt : pas de navigateur de dossiers/fichiers, pas de compatibilité avec Portainer, pas de montage SMB, aucune gestion matérielle …
      Il faut faire attention à la notion d’installation d’apps en 1 clic, nous sommes sur du Docker et toutes les apps ont besoin d’une configuration complémentaire. Configuration facile pour les services ne comportant qu’une image mais compliqué avec plusieurs images (ex DB + html) et, concernant Runtipi la modification des YAML sera des plus complexe pour un débutant.
      Runtipi a le mérite d’exister (merci aux développeurs) mais ne présente aucun intérêt pour un débutant – + simple d’utiliser Portainer avec un tableau de bord simple.

      Comparativement, CasaOS est beaucoup + abouti au niveau de l’interface avec contrôle du matériel, Navigateur de Fichiers, montage SMB, configuration des apps un peu + simple …

      1. Et pour CasaOS ?
        Au niveau maintenance et sécurité ?
        Est fiable?
        Ou vaut il mieux contrôler tout via Portainer par ex, ou autre?
        Merci pour vos retours

  2. Je teste encore mais c’est en cours d’adoption chez moi.
    Cela ressemble à du portainer+traefik avec un app store (plutôt riche) en plus et des configurations en moins.

    C’est proche de yunohost parce qu’il y a un store mais la comparaison s’arrête là, yunohost permet une intégration des apps dans un même écosystème.

    Runtipi permet de choisir un app, de lancer son installation en choisissant un ou deux paramètres si besoin (le nom de domaine par exemple), et c’est tout.

    Il peut y avoir un dossier commun pour les apps dans lequel on peut monter ce qu’on veut (runtipi/media/data).
    Il est possible d’aller plus loin, mais ça ne m’intéresse pas spécialement.

    Ça juste marche.

  3. J’ai testé et suis revenu à casaos pour mon servarr*. L’avantage de runtipi c’est le traefik intégré mais les maj sont mal gérées et endommage le container. Je n’ai par exemple jamais réussi à maj Immich. CasaOS présente bien plus d’avantage à mes yeux. Bon après mon casa roule sur une VM dans proxmox donc niveau backup c’est royal

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*

Ce site utilise Akismet pour réduire les indésirables. En savoir plus sur la façon dont les données de vos commentaires sont traitées.